### Account Recovery — Catalogue Import (Lintwood)

Quick one for review: when the Lintwood catalogue import wipes a patron's session table, the recovery flow re-seeds accounts from the nightly snapshot. Check that the importer skips locked accounts — last time it didn't. To rerun recovery against staging you'll need the vault passphrase, which is appended just below.

recovery phrase for yafof-tajof: julmir-kelax-julvan-holath-belvan-holir-ralael-ralvan-ralath-julvan-silmir-istmir-kaswyn-ulamir

### Account Recovery — CSV Import Wizard

Scope: Tallowmere import wizard operator accounts only. Steps: confirm requester identity per the contractor checklist. Disable active import jobs first — recovery mid-import corrupts row mappings. Reset the operator account from the admin panel, then re-link the wizard's staging bucket. Do not re-run failed imports until mappings are verified. Final step requires the recovery console, which prompts on launch. Authenticate using the passphrase below.

recovery phrase for fawif-tajeg: norael-aldmir-casir-brivan-ulaion

Hey Priya — handing off the webhook delivery work on Fennelgate before I'm out next week. Quick context for review: we retry failed deliveries with exponential backoff, but the old code treated any 4xx as retryable, which hammered partners with bad endpoints. New behavior: only 429 and 5xx retry, capped at six attempts, then we park the event in the dead-letter table for manual replay. Tests cover the jitter math. The staging service is already running with the settings below.

settings of bawif-fawif:
ralix:
  log_level: warn
  metrics_host: metrics.ralix.tolvaqsys.internal
  pool_size: 32